InsideDesk, a leading provider of AI-powered revenue cycle management (RCM) solutions for dental service organizations (DSOs), raised $12.6 million in funding led by Pender Ventures with participation from existing investors Round13 Capital and Graphite Ventures.
InsideDesk is already delivering measurable results for the organizations it serves. MB2 Dental, one of the nation’s largest Dental Partnership Organizations, has used InsideDesk to improve visibility into revenue cycle performance and identify additional collection opportunities across its organization. That impact has driven growing demand for the company’s AI-driven solutions as dental organizations look to do more with leaner teams amid increasingly complex payor requirements.
InsideDesk said the new round will fund deeper investment in artificial intelligence and automation and support key hires across engineering, AI, and go-to-market as InsideDesk scales to meet growing demand and extends its leadership in AI-powered revenue cycle management.
